  • Patent number: 4336551
    Abstract: A thick-film printed circuit board and a method for producing the same are disclosed, in which wiring conductors having connecting sections for connection with solder electrodes of an electronic element such as a semiconductor chip are provided on an insulating substrate. A layer of insulating material having through holes at positions corresponding to the connecting terminals of the electronic element is covered on the wiring conductors. Conductor pedestals for connection with the electronic element are filled in the through holes and formed on the insulating layer. Each of the pedestals has an area for contact with the connecting terminals of the electronic element.

  • Patent number: 4091391
    Abstract: A plurality of drive leads are taken out of the opposite outer ends of a thermal resistor assembly including a plurality of series-connected thermal resistor elements and junction points between adjacent ones of the thermal resistor elements, thereby dividing the drive leads to alternately belong to a first and a second set of drive leads. The drive leads of the second set of drive leads are further divided to alternately belong to a first and a second group. At least one of the drive leads of the first set of drive leads is selected in accordance with a given pattern and connected to recording signal input means. At the same time, one of the first and second group is selected in accordance with the given pattern, and a common power supply line associated with the selected group is connected to first potential means, a common power supply line associated with the group being connected to second potential means.
